Clutch Control and Hill Starts

One major aspect of driving the manual Daihatsu Xenia is clutch control. This skill is vital,

especially in stop-and-go traffic or on hilly terrain.

To avoid stalling, practice the “bite point” of the clutch — the moment where the clutch

starts to engage the engine. For hill starts, use the handbrake to prevent rollback, gently

release the clutch to the bite point, and then ease off the brake while accelerating.

Performance and Driving Dynamics

One of the defining characteristics of the manual Daihatsu Xenia is its driving dynamics.

The 5-speed manual transmission provides responsive gear shifts and a sense of driver

involvement that many automatic transmissions lack. When paired with the Xenia’s

modest engine options—often ranging between 1.0L to 1.3L—the manual gearbox

optimizes fuel consumption without compromising adequate power delivery.

Engine Compatibility and Fuel Efficiency

The manual Daihatsu Xenia is commonly equipped with a 1.3L 4-cylinder petrol engine,

capable of producing around 92 horsepower and 117 Nm of torque. This engine, combined

with the manual transmission, enables a fuel economy rate that averages approximately

12 to 15 kilometers per liter under mixed driving conditions. Such figures make the

manual Daihatsu Xenia a practical choice for daily commuting and family transportation.

Handling and Ride Comfort

Drivers of the manual Daihatsu Xenia often report a balanced handling experience. The

manual transmission allows for better control when accelerating or decelerating on

inclines or uneven terrain. The suspension system—typically a MacPherson strut upfront

and a torsion beam rear—offers a comfortable ride, although some may find the rear

suspension slightly firm compared to larger MPVs.

Comparative Analysis: Manual Daihatsu Xenia vs. Competitors

In the crowded MPV market, the manual Daihatsu Xenia competes with models such as

the Toyota Avanza, Suzuki Ertiga, and Honda Mobilio. Each of these rivals offers manual

transmission options, but subtle differences set the Xenia apart.

Fuel Efficiency

The Daihatsu Xenia's manual transmission variant tends to edge out competitors slightly

in fuel efficiency, primarily due to its lightweight build and optimized engine tuning. For

instance, while the Toyota Avanza manual version offers similar mileage, the Xenia’s

lower curb weight contributes to better fuel economy in stop-and-go traffic.

Price and Maintenance Costs

One of the most significant advantages of the manual Daihatsu Xenia is its affordability.

The initial purchase price is competitive, and the manual transmission reduces the

complexity of repairs and routine maintenance. Manual gearboxes generally have fewer

components than automatic counterparts, which translates into lower servicing costs over

the vehicle’s lifespan.

Driving Experience

For drivers who prefer an interactive and engaging driving experience, the manual

Daihatsu Xenia offers a noticeable advantage over automatic MPVs. The ability to

manually select gears enhances control, especially in hilly regions common in Indonesia.

However, it may not be the preferred choice for city drivers who face heavy traffic jams

where frequent clutch usage can become tiresome.

Maintenance and Longevity Considerations

Owners of the manual Daihatsu Xenia often benefit from the vehicle’s straightforward

mechanical layout. Manual transmissions are known for their durability when properly

maintained, requiring periodic clutch adjustments and fluid changes. The availability of

spare parts and widespread service centers for Daihatsu vehicles in Indonesia further

supports the longevity of the manual Xenia.

Routine maintenance schedules emphasize oil changes every 5,000 to 10,000 kilometers

and transmission fluid checks every 40,000 kilometers or as recommended by the

manufacturer. Drivers who master smooth clutch engagement can extend the lifespan of

the manual gearbox significantly, enhancing resale value.
